Output afc308a79ee7630d6743749d8c47e270e3272daef2081d32cab933be149ad122:154

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 595b1793b230b083982f29391922ee1a4835d15ef92c4507bf9fa344a9e8ee3b
address
tb1pt9d30yajxzcg8xp09yu3jghwrfyrt527lyky2paln735f20gacas24du0m
transaction
afc308a79ee7630d6743749d8c47e270e3272daef2081d32cab933be149ad122